The Science of Executive Wellness

Executive wellness is grounded in the science of allostatic load—the cumulative burden of chronic stress on the body. High-pressure roles can dysregulate the hypothalamic-pituitary-adrenal (HPA) axis, leading to elevated cortisol, impaired recovery, and reduced cognitive function. A scientifically-sound corporate fitness program directly counters this by:

Physiological Benefits:

  • Stress Resilience: Regular, structured exercise modulates the HPA axis, improving the body's stress response and lowering baseline cortisol.
  • Cognitive Enhancement: Exercise boosts Brain-Derived Neurotrophic Factor (BDNF), enhancing memory, decision-making, and neuroplasticity.
  • Metabolic Protection: Counteracts the sedentary effects of desk work, improving insulin sensitivity and cardiovascular health.
  • Leadership Resilience: By improving sleep quality, emotional regulation, and energy systems, training directly supports the mental fortitude required for leadership.

Technical Note: The Principle of Hormetic Stress. Qualified experts understand hormesis—the concept that a measured, applied stressor (like exercise) triggers an adaptive, strengthening response in the body. They strategically apply physical stress through resistance and conditioning to build a robust physiological buffer against the chronic psychological stress of executive life. This is a key benchmark for effective programming.

Expert Executive Wellness & Corporate Fitness Q&A

What specific certifications qualify a professional for executive wellness and corporate fitness coaching?

The most authoritative credentials include the ACSM Certified Exercise Physiologist (EP-C), the NSCA Certified Strength and Conditioning Specialist (CSCS) with corporate wellness experience, and the National Board for Health & Wellness Coaching (NBHWC) certification. Additional specialized training in stress physiology, behavioral change psychology, and ergonomic assessment—such as the Certified Workplace Wellness Specialist credential—signals competency in addressing the unique allostatic load challenges facing leadership populations.

How does executive wellness programming differ methodologically from general fitness training?

Executive programming is built around the principle of hormetic stress—applying measured physiological stressors through time-efficient compound movements, high-density interval protocols, and strategic respiratory work to build a robust adaptive buffer against chronic occupational stress. Unlike general fitness which prioritizes volume or aesthetics, executive protocols manipulate the work-to-rest ratio to maximize BDNF expression and cognitive enhancement within compressed 30-45 minute windows. Programming integrates nervous system down-regulation techniques like paced breathing and mindfulness directly into cool-down phases, treating recovery as a trainable performance variable rather than passive rest.

What safety assessments and contraindication screenings are essential for executive fitness clients?

An certified expert must conduct a comprehensive pre-participation screening addressing cardiovascular risk stratification given the high-stress demographic, postural assessment for prolonged sitting-related kyphotic and lordotic deviations, and baseline blood pressure monitoring given the prevalence of hypertension in executive populations. The trainer must assess for contraindications including uncontrolled hypertension during high-intensity intervals, cervical spine issues from extended screen time, and carpal tunnel or thoracic outlet symptoms. A physician clearance and lipid panel review are strongly recommended before initiating high-intensity protocols.

What realistic cognitive and physiological outcomes should an executive expect from a wellness program?

Measurable reductions in perceived stress scores and resting heart rate typically emerge within 3 to 4 weeks of consistent training. Improved sleep quality metrics—including sleep latency and sleep efficiency—commonly manifest within 4 to 6 weeks. Significant improvements in VO2 max, insulin sensitivity, and subjective cognitive performance (focus, decision-making clarity) require a sustained commitment of 8 to 12 weeks. Your certified expert should establish baseline metrics including heart rate variability, perceived stress scale scores, and submaximal cardiovascular assessments, then reassess at regular intervals to quantify the ROI of your wellness investment.
